다음을 통해 공유


IQueryInfo::GetInfoTip 메서드(shlobj_core.h)

항목에 대한 정보 팁 텍스트를 가져옵니다.

구문

HRESULT GetInfoTip(
        DWORD dwFlags,
  [out] PWSTR *ppwszTip
);

매개 변수

dwFlags

형식:DWORD

정보 팁 텍스트를 검색할 항목의 처리를 지시하는 플래그입니다. 이 값은 일반적으로 0(QITIPF_DEFAULT)입니다. 다음 값이 인식됩니다.

QITIPF_DEFAULT(0x00000000)

특별한 처리가 없습니다.

QITIPF_USENAME(0x00000001)

정보 팁 텍스트가 아닌 ppwszTip 에 항목의 이름을 입력합니다.

QITIPF_LINKNOTARGET(0x00000002)

항목이 바로 가기인 경우 대상이 아닌 바로 가기의 정보 팁 텍스트를 검색합니다.

QITIPF_LINKUSETARGET(0x00000004)

항목이 바로 가기인 경우 바로 가기 대상의 정보 팁 텍스트를 검색합니다.

QITIPF_USESLOWTIP(0x00000008)

전체 네임스페이스에서 정보를 검색합니다. 이 값은 응답 시간이 지연될 수 있습니다.

QITIPF_SINGLELINE(0x00000010)

Windows Vista 이상. 정보 팁을 한 줄에 배치합니다.

[out] ppwszTip

형식: PWSTR*

이 메서드가 성공적으로 반환될 때 팁 문자열 포인터를 수신하는 유니코드 문자열 포인터의 주소입니다. 이 메서드를 구현하는 애플리케이션은 CoTaskMemAlloc을 호출하여 ppwszTip에 대한 메모리를 할당해야 합니다. 호출하는 애플리케이션은 더 이상 필요하지 않을 때 메모리를 해제하려면 CoTaskMemFree 를 호출해야 합니다.

반환 값

형식: HRESULT

함수가 성공하면 S_OK 반환합니다. 정보 팁 텍스트를 사용할 수 없는 경우 ppwszTipNULL로 설정됩니다. 그렇지 않으면 COM에서 정의한 오류 값을 반환합니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ows 2000 Professional, Windows XP [데스크톱 앱만 해당]
지원되는 최소 서버 Windows 2000 Server[데스크톱 앱만]
대상 플랫폼 Windows
헤더 shlobj_core.h
DLL Shell32.dll(버전 4.71 이상)

추가 정보

IQueryInfo